Sitting on a block in excess of 1700mts this solid 3 bedroom brick home is ready and waiting. Features include a walk in robe and ensuite off the main bedroom. Lovely big living room with bay window. Spacious family room / meals area off the kitchen. Open plan timber kitchen with upgraded appliances. Gas Ducted heating and split system air conditioner. Outside there's an massive undercover area off the rear. Handy 6 x 9 mtr shed with access off the side road. Double garage including remote door.
